If you smell a foul, rotten egg-like odor in your home it may be the result of sewer gas. That unpleasant odor is caused by hydrogen sulfide, methane, ammonia, and other volatile gases that are a byproduct of decomposing waste in your house’s drains and pipes. These gases are heavier than air and can accumulate in basements and other low-lying areas. They can also cause a variety of symptoms, including eye irritation, nausea, and dizziness. If the odor does go away, you may have a simple solution to the problem. Most floor drains (in basements or utility rooms) are supposed to have water in a trap to prevent sewer gases from entering living spaces. If the water in your trap has evaporated, or if there is a crack in the trap, sewer gas may be entering your home through that point.

A professional plumber can perform a quick and inexpensive inspection to find the source of sewer gas in your home. They’ll use a special device to insert colored vapor into your plumbing pipes. This vapor will show up where the leak is located, making it much easier for your plumber to find and repair the source of that bad odor.

The most common cause of yellowing pepper leaves is nutrient deficiency, especially nitrogen. This can occur when the soil is not rich enough and the plant starts to starve. Luckily, this can easily be corrected with fertilizer.

Another cause of yellowing pepper leaves is water stress. Since peppers love hot conditions, they can quickly become dehydrated. This causes them to wilt and turn yellow, along with reduced pepper production and stunted growth. Fortunately, this is also easy to fix with a consistent watering schedule.

A deficiency in magnesium and calcium can also lead to yellowing pepper leaves. These nutrients play a crucial role in pepper plant growth and flower setting, so it is very important to ensure they are present in your garden soil.

Dr Pepper was first formulated by pharmacist Charles Alderton in Morrison’s Old Corner Drug Store in Waco, Texas. He noticed that customers of the store could never decide what flavor they wanted to order, and so he came up with his own drink that blended many different flavors together. Alderton named the drink after a beautiful young girl that he was in love with at the time. The name has since become legendary, and the brand is one of the most popular in the world today.

A good campfire cooking equipment set will have a pot, pans, and a grill or griddle. Ideally, the pans should be made of metal that won’t melt. The set should also have a cover to protect the food and prevent burning. Look for a lid with a vent so you can easily strain liquids.

Another great piece of campfire cooking equipment is a pair of long locking tongs. These will give you comfortable distance from the hot coals and make it easy to flip burgers or pull steak off the grill. You can also use the tongs to handle skewers, such as for a chicken leg or veggie kabobs.

When refrigerated, kombucha stops the fermentation process and remains at its original acidity and alcohol level. If left out, however, kombucha will continue to ferment and can become dry and vinegary. In extreme cases, the bottle may explode, resulting in what’s called a “Bottle Bomb.”
